Manchester United midfielder Kobbie Mainoo starred on his first start for England against Belgium on Tuesday night, scooping the Man of the Match award.
The 18-year-old, who has enjoyed a sharp rise this season, was awarded his full debut for the Three Lions after stepping off the bench in Saturday's 1-0 defeat to Brazil.
He started in a midfield trio alongside Declan Rice and Jude Bellingham, putting himself in the frame for a starting berth at the European Championship this summer.
It was argued prior to Tuesday night's 2-2 draw at Wembley that Mainoo would complete the ideal midfield for England, complementing the qualities of Rice and Bellingham in the engine room.
